Nauve Surname Meaning

Historically, surnames evolved as a way to sort people into groups - by occupation, place of origin, clan affiliation, patronage, parentage, adoption, and even physical characteristics (like red hair). Many of the modern surnames in the dictionary can be traced back to Britain and Ireland.

Where is the Nauve family from?

You can see how Nauve families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Nauve family name was found in the USA in 1920. In 1920 there was 1 Nauve family living in Ohio. This was 100% of all the recorded Nauve's in USA. Ohio had the highest population of Nauve families in 1920.
